He shields in the direction of the furthest enemy from him (not always the enemy in the corner). So if the enemy has assassins jumped onto you backline far from Braum, he will shield in that direction.

If you are anticipating matching up against people with assassins, consider putting Braum closer to your backline.

It is a bit annoying when he puts his shield up the wrong way, but he is far from useless. Braum is one of my favorite units in the game, actually. If you get him a thornmail, dragons claw, and warmogs he's nigh unkillable against many team comps (major exceptions being void or a stacked Vayne).
